thanks so much for the assistance with the images of the OSV Sport bicycles, greatly appreciated
they appear to date from ca. 1973
do not recognise a manufacturer
suspect they were contract produced for a chain store or distributor
there is indeed a France based entity called OSV Sport, with the letters standing for "Outdoor Sports Valley"
it seems to be an umbrella sort of organization with the goal of supporting/promoting outdoor sports -
Homepage - Outdoor Sports Valleyhttps://www.outdoorsportsvalley.org › ...
rather than being of Frankish origin the machines themselves are clearly Italian products
their only France origin fitting from what can be discerned in the posted images is their NERVAR Sport cottered chainsets -
note the Italian national colour bands on the foil seat tube transfer -
the "bullet" treatment on the seat stays is a very Italian trait
the cycle's headset is Way-Assauto
the brake cable clips and pump cup are REG (Rampinelli)
find meself wondering if the OSV Sport referred to in the transfers is some now gone sports equipment company that decided to add cycles to their offerings during "the boom" of the early 1970's...
